Bloomberg Touts New Toronto Ticker

Bloomberg has gone live with a new ticker plant in Toronto, to provide financial firms with faster access to data captured from Canadian exchanges, reducing latency by 71 percent compared to its previous offering.

BATS Readies Consolidated BATS-Direct Edge Feed

BATS Global Markets is preparing to release a feed of market data that provides a base of information from all four equities markets run by its BATS and Direct Edge exchanges, following the merger of the two exchange operators at the start of this year.
